John R. Garton, 88 years of age, of Jansen passed away Thursday, June 3, 2021 at Heritage Care Center in Fairbury. He was born on April 13, 1933 at Shea to Clifford and Fern (Camp) Garton. John graduated from Beatrice High School in 1951. He served his country in the United States Army from June 16, 1953 to May 20, 1955 and was stationed in France. John went to horseshoeing school at Golden Leaf Farrier College in South Dakota. He started operating a bulldozer when he was in high school for his uncle and was a lifelong farmer. John was a lifetime member of the American Quarter Horse Association and a member of the American Legion Bitting-Norman Post #27 in Beatrice. He enjoyed working, visiting, welding and telling jokes.
John is survived by special friend, Geneva Cramer of Beatrice; sister, Beverly Rhine of Liberty; brother, Dan Garton of Jansen; and several nieces nephews and cousins. He was preceded in death by his parents; sister, Arlene Whitaker and husband Richard; and brother-in-law, Burt Rhine.
